The Suspension Clamp is a critical engineered component used in power transmission and communication networks to securely suspend and support overhead wires. Designed for high-performance stability, it ensures that ADSS cables, OPGW cables, and various power wires are firmly fixed to power towers, poles, or other support structures, effectively eliminating the risk of offset or sagging caused by wind, temperature fluctuations, and other environmental stressors.

Utilizing a sophisticated combination of inner and outer spiral pre-stranded wires, our suspension clamps protect optical cables from concentrated stress and bending fatigue while providing essential vibration reduction. With a grip force exceeding 10%-20% of the cable's rated tensile strength, these clamps offer a reliable, long-term solution for maintaining the structural integrity of high-altitude power and communication lines across diverse terrains.

Frequently Asked Questions

Q: What is the primary purpose of a Suspension Clamp in power lines?

The primary purpose is to securely support and suspend overhead wires on power towers or poles, ensuring stability against wind and temperature changes while preventing the cable from slipping.

Q: Which cable types are compatible with these clamps?

They are highly versatile and suitable for ADSS cables, OPGW cables, bare aluminum wires, aluminum alloy wires, copper wires, and various optical fibers.

Q: How do Suspension Clamps protect optical cables from damage?

Through a combination of inner and outer spiral pre-stranded wires, the clamp prevents concentrated stress and bending, while also reducing harmful vibrations.

Q: What should be done if the deflection angle exceeds the maximum limit?

If the angle is too great, you should implement measures such as switching to double wire clips, adjusting the tower height, or utilizing a custom-designed wire clip.

Q: What materials are used to ensure corrosion resistance?

We use high-strength, corrosion-resistant materials including hot-dip galvanized steel, high-grade aluminum alloys, and stainless steel to withstand humid and salty environments.

Q: How is the grip force of the clamp measured?

The grip force is designed to be greater than 10%-20% of the rated tensile strength of the cable, ensuring the wire remains secure under maximum load.
